Drinking Water Grade Polyaluminum Chloride (PAC) 30%

Polyaluminum Chloride (PAC) is an advanced coagulant used in water treatment for clarifying drinking water and industrial wastewater. Known for its high efficiency, PAC improves water quality by removing suspended solids and organic contaminants. It is widely used in municipal water treatment, paper mills, and more.

Product Scope

PAC is an aluminium-based coagulant. In a suitable treatment train, it may be evaluated to support clarification by bringing suspended particles together before a downstream separation step such as sedimentation, flotation, or filtration. This page supports product review and procurement; it does not replace treatment design, regulatory approval, or site testing.

Selection and Documentation

  • Define the water source, treatment objective, raw-water conditions, and downstream separation process.

  • Request the current technical data sheet, COA, SDS, and any required drinking-water or product-contact documentation for the exact grade.

  • Use representative jar tests, bench tests, or pilot trials to establish suitability and operating conditions.

  • Confirm the approved addition point, solution preparation method, and dosage through site testing and supplier guidance rather than a generic fixed concentration.

Preparation, Storage, and Handling

Follow the current technical guidance and SDS supplied for the exact product grade. Store sealed material in a clean, dry location and use appropriate controls for handling powders. Confirm site procedures for solution make-up, spill response, and disposal before operation.
